About a month ago I installed some new ballasts for my HIDs (Keep in mind I have the relay and wiring straight to the battery). When I turned them on I kept hearing a sound weird sound coming from the front of the car (Might have been the ballasts or might have been something else). Needless to say I decided not to use those ballasts. From then on I started to have two problems.

1. My A/C and lower control buttons only light up when I have the parking or headlights on NOT when I just have the DRLs on. I can't see if I have the A/C, rear defrost ect. buttons on while the DRLs are on. The buttons wont light up although they will when I have the headlights or parking lights on.

2. My airbag light keeps coming on and off randomly while I driving. I read the code and its B0041 (LF side deployment loop open.)

--I tried reinstalling my original PCM with nothing changed. Could this be a bad DRL relay causing a short or would it more than likely be the BCM is bad?
 


Maybe when you installed the ballasts a fuse or two blew. Check out your fuse boxes.

Checked all the fuses and nothing has blown. Plus the A/C controls light up but not when the DRLs are on? I might try and replace the DRL relay but am open to suggestions. I don't think the DRL relay could be setting the Airbag light though.
 
Well the two issues were coincidence because I fixed the airbag problem. It was the connector under the seat. The wires going into the yellow connector were loose I wiggled it around to see if it was the problem and sure enough it was. Now I am still trying to figure out the climate controls. I bought some relays, installed them and nothing changed. The only thing I can think to do next is replace the climate controls and see if that works. I checked the grounds and even checked the grounding strap that is under the airbox (now a K&N CAI) and they look good.
 


pull your fuse box and make sure nothing got hot on the back of it. sounds like you have some wires touching together behind the fusebox.
